Initial Steps to Diagnose the Problem

Man coding on multiple monitors in a modern office at night.

Start by checking the Windows Event Viewer to get more details about the BSOD error. This tool logs system events and can provide critical clues about what triggered the crash. Once identified, the error code and details should be noted. Running a full scan with CrowdStrike to check for any pending updates or known issues is also advisable. Making sure that both your operating system and CrowdStrike software are up-to-date can often resolve compatibility issues that lead to BSODs.

Common Causes and Their Solutions

Addressing the common causes of BSOD due to CrowdStrike is the best way to remediate and avoid recurrent issues. Here’s what you might discover and how you can address them:

  • Driver Conflicts: Ensure all drivers are up to date using a reliable driver update tool or through Windows Update.
  • Software Conflicts: Disable or uninstall any recently installed software that could be interfering with CrowdStrike.
  • Configuration Errors: Check CrowdStrike configurations and make sure they align with your system settings to avoid unnecessary processing conflicts.

Advanced Troubleshooting Methods

If the BSOD issues persist, you may need to delve into more advanced troubleshooting methods. Here’s a step-by-step approach:

  1. Boot into Safe Mode: This step can help determine if background programs are causing the clash.
  2. Reinstall CrowdStrike: Uninstall the CrowdStrike client and then reinstall the latest version to ensure no files are corrupt.
  3. Contact Support: If you’re still facing issues, reaching out to CrowdStrike support can provide you with solutions specific to your scenario.
